What are the signs a 2025 Honda Odyssey needs transmission service?
Typical 2025 Honda Odyssey transmission warning signs include delayed or harsh engagement, slipping under load, shudder at light throttle, burnt-smelling or dark fluid, and dash warnings.
Any of these symptoms on a 2025 Honda Odyssey should prompt a professional evaluation in Palm Harbor to prevent further wear. Courtesy Palm Harbor Honda can confirm whether the concern is fluid-related or mechanical, then advise the appropriate next step. Because symptoms overlap, a fluid change alone may not resolve an underlying fault.
- Delayed or harsh engagement when shifting from Park to Drive/Reverse
- Shudder or flare during light acceleration or at steady cruise
- Whine/hum that changes with gear, or a stored transmission fault code

What's included in a 2025 Honda Odyssey transmission service?
Service typically includes a fluid-level/condition check, scan for transmission fault codes, the selected drain-and-fill or exchange, temperature-correct refill, and a road test.
For a 2025 Honda Odyssey in Palm Harbor, our team follows the model’s 10-speed automatic procedures and documents results. Where design allows, gasket and filter components are addressed per inspection findings. You’ll receive clear findings and next-step recommendations.
- Inspection of fluid level/condition and any leaks
- Scan-tool check for stored transmission DTCs
- Temperature-verified fill and final road test
Drain-and-fill or full fluid exchange — which does a 2025 Honda Odyssey need?
The right choice depends on current fluid condition and service history for the Odyssey’s 10-speed automatic—inspection comes first.
A drain-and-fill refreshes a portion of the existing fluid and is often appropriate for routine maintenance. A complete exchange replaces more of the system’s fluid and may be considered when fluid is severely degraded. Courtesy Palm Harbor Honda inspects before recommending the least invasive option that meets the need.
- Service history determines the approach
- Fluid color/odor and scan data guide the decision
- Temperature-correct refill verified after either service
Do Palm Harbor heat and traffic affect 2025 Honda Odyssey transmission service needs?
High ambient heat and stop-and-go traffic raise transmission fluid temperatures, which can shorten fluid life in a 2025 Honda Odyssey.
Pinellas County’s warm climate and urban traffic increase thermal load on automatic transmissions. If you frequently idle in congestion, tow, or drive in hot conditions around Tampa and Clearwater, consider more frequent inspections. Our Palm Harbor shop can check fluid condition and advise timing.
- Heat is the primary stressor for automatic transmission fluid
- Towing and heavy passenger/cargo loads add thermal load
- Periodic inspections help catch issues early

What’s Included in a 2025 Honda Odyssey Transmission Service
On a 2025 Honda Odyssey, transmission service begins with a fluid-level and condition check, plus a scan for stored transmission fault codes. Based on findings and your service history, we’ll recommend either a drain-and-fill or a more complete exchange; where design allows, pan gasket and filter components are addressed per inspection. The unit is then refilled to the factory temperature specification, verified with a scan tool, and road-tested to confirm shift quality.
